About SharePad
What is SharePad?
SharePad is a privacy-first, markdown-first collaboration notepad designed to make sharing notes as simple as sharing a link. Create a pad in seconds, write in Markdown, and collaborate without creating an account or signing in.
Whether you're sharing documentation, meeting notes, code snippets, or temporary information, SharePad aims to provide a fast, lightweight, and secure experience with minimal friction.

How It Works
- Choose a unique URL slug (the address of your pad) and optionally protect it with a password.
- Create or edit your content using Markdown.
- Your changes are saved automatically.
- Share the link with others. Anyone with the URL can access the pad. If a password is set, the correct password is also required.
- Pads automatically expire after the configured inactivity period since their last access to help reduce unused data.

Privacy & Security
Protecting your privacy is one of SharePad's primary goals.
- Minimal Data Collection: SharePad does not require user accounts. During normal use, we do not collect personal information beyond what is necessary to operate the service. If you contact us, we collect only the information you voluntarily provide to respond to your inquiry.
- Password-Protected Encryption: Protected pads are encrypted before they leave your device. Without the correct password, neither SharePad nor anyone with access to the server can read their contents.
- HTTP-Only Sessions: Protected pad access uses HTTP-only session cookies, helping protect authentication cookies from being accessed by client-side JavaScript.
- Automatic Expiry: Every pad is automatically deleted after the configured inactivity period since their last access.
- No Built-in Backups: SharePad should not be used as your only copy of important information. Maintain your own backups for content you cannot afford to lose.
- Abuse Protection: Rate limiting and other technical safeguards help protect the platform from abuse and maintain service stability.

Open Source
SharePad is open source and licensed under the GNU Affero General Public License v3.0 (AGPL-3.0-only). You are welcome to inspect the source code, report issues, suggest improvements, and contribute to the project.
